Manufacturer & Distributor Guidelines for Obtaining PDGA Approval of Golf Discs and Targets
Revised and effective June 12, 2025.
Pricing Updates
Tariffs, Taxes, and Fees
In addition to the testing fee, manufacturers/distributors are responsible for reimbursing PDGA for any associated taxes, tariffs, or fees associated with taking delivery of the provided samples.
Targets
Effective April 1, 2024, the fee for testing each target will increase from $350 to $500 USD. If a target is not approved, an explanation of the testing failure and a refund of $250 USD will be sent to the manufacturer/distributor.
Discs
Effective April 1, 2024, the fee for testing each disc will increase from $300 to $500 USD.
New Manufacturer/Distributor Discounts
As of January 1, 2024, new manufacturers/distributors who are in their first calendar year of submitting discs for PDGA approval will no longer receive a 50% discount on testing fees.
Manufacturer/Distributor Transfer
When a manufacturer/distributor takes over and releases a previously approved disc acquired from another manufacturer/distributor, the fee is $100 USD.
